Output 3dd975feb2d8fc24f35b8901daa468c8d9c9eb23a03e8aa0697b953ca92413d1:1

value
10366442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18c721aae3458931ecf0a4bef647efe2bae5becd OP_EQUAL
address
33x2h3j8EsWRbQE37D9pETjyh8kqoWKNVf
transaction
3dd975feb2d8fc24f35b8901daa468c8d9c9eb23a03e8aa0697b953ca92413d1
confirmations
422101
spent
true